Ingredients

  • 8 boneless, skinless chicken thighs
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 5 garlic cloves, minced
  • ⅓ cup honey
  • 2 tablespoons low-sodium so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• ½ teaspoon dried thyme
  • ½ teaspoon dried oregano
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on cornstarch
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ish
  • Sesame seeds for garnish (optional)

Kitchen Equipment

  • Large skillet
  • Mixing bowl
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Tongs
  • Meat thermometer

How to Make Honey Garlic Chicken Thighs

Step 1: Season the Chicken

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els. Season both sides with paprika, onion powder, thyme, oregano, salt, and black pepper.

Step 2: Sear the Chicken

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Cook the chicken thighs for about 6–7 minutes per side until golden brown. Remove from the skillet and set aside.

Step 3: Prepare the Honey Garlic Sauce

Reduce the heat to medium.

Add the minced garlic and c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ant.

Stir in the honey, soy sauce, and apple cider vinegar.

In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ch with the water, then stir it into the sauce. Cook for 2–3 minutes until slightly thickened.

Step 4: Finish Cooking

Return the chicken thighs to the skillet.

Spoon the sauce over the chicken and simmer for 6–8 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).

Step 5: Garnish and Serve

Sprinkle with chopped parsley and sesame seeds before serving.

Tips for the Best Honey Garlic Chicken Thighs

  • Pat the chicken dry before cooking for better browning.
  • Fresh garlic provides the richest flavor.
  • Avoid overheating the honey to preserve its natural sweetness.
  • Use a meat thermometer for perfectly cooked chicken.
  •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Delicious Variations

Baked Honey Garlic Chicken Thighs

Bake at 400°F (200°C) for 30–35 minutes, then brush with the honey garlic sauce during the final 10 minutes.

Spicy Honey Garlic Chicken

Add crushed red pepper flakes or a pinch of cayenne pepper to the sauce.

Honey Garlic Chicken with Vegetables

Cook broccoli, carrots, bell peppers, or green beans in the same skillet for an easy one-pan dinner.

Lemon Honey Garlic Chicken

Add fresh lemon juice and a little lemon zest to brighten the flavors.

Storage Instructions

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

Freeze cooked chicken for up to 3 months.

Reheating

Reheat gently in a skillet over medium-low heat or in the microwave until warmed through. Add a splash of chicken broth if the sauce becomes too thick.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use bone-in chicken thighs?

Yes. Bone-in chicken thighs work well but usually require a longer cooking time.

Can I make this recipe ahead of time?

Absolutely. Store it in the refrigerator and reheat before serving. The flavors become even better the next day.

Can I use chicken breasts instead?

Yes. Chicken breasts can be used, but watch the cooking time to prevent them from drying out.

How do I know when the chicken is fully cooked?

The safest way is to use a meat thermometer.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C).

Can I freeze Honey Garlic Chicken Thighs?

Yes. Let the chicken cool completely before freezing it in an airtight container for up to 3 months.
